I stayed in Tuscany for about 2 months and loved it! I lived in a small town called Castiglion Fiorentino. The landscapes are amazing, incredibly picturesque. The culture where I lived was very easy to adjust to. The people are very easy going and passive. There is a lot of history in the region, Etruscan and Medieval. A lot of history in the arts as well, towns in which the old masters (Da vinci, Michelangelo, Caravaggio) were born or worked. Great wineries as well, those are a pleasant visit.
